Abstract

The utility model discloses a smearing device for rust prevention of a cutter, which comprises a oiling station, wherein the top of the oiling station is provided with a clamping groove, a cutter handle is clamped in the clamping groove, the top of the cutter handle is fixedly connected with a cutter body, the top of the oiling station is fixedly connected with a vertical block, the top of the vertical block is fixedly connected with a motor frame, the inside of the motor frame is fixedly connected with a motor, and the surface of an output shaft of the motor is fixedly connected with a bidirectional threaded rod through a coupling. Technical Field
The utility model relates to the technical field of rust prevention of cutters, in particular to smearing equipment for rust prevention of cutters.
Background
The traditional cutter is often smeared manually when smeared with rust-preventive oil, but because of the double-sided shape of the cutter, the rust-preventive smearing of the cutter also comprises two parts of oil spraying and smearing, and when smeared with a plurality of cutters, a great deal of manpower is consumed, so that the rust-preventive smearing equipment for the cutter is designed.
Disclosure of Invention
Aiming at the defects of the prior art, the utility model provides the smearing equipment for rust prevention of the cutter, which solves the problem that the traditional cutter consumes manpower when the cutter is used for rust prevention and oiling.

Preferably, the oiling mechanism comprises a connecting block, one side of the connecting block is fixedly connected with one side of the displacement block, and a fixing groove is formed in one side of the connecting block.
Preferably, the inside fixedly connected with electric power telescopic link of fixed slot, electric power telescopic link one end fixedly connected with connecting block, one side fixedly connected with of connecting block smears the oil block.
Preferably, the two opposite sides of the oil smearing block are fixedly connected with oil smearing brushes, the cutter body is positioned between the two oil smearing blocks, and the top of the connecting block is fixedly connected with a bump.
Preferably, the top fixedly connected with oil nozzle of lug, one side intercommunication of oil nozzle is connected with the oil delivery pipe, the one end intercommunication of oil delivery pipe is connected with rust-resistant oil tank.
Preferably, the surface of the oil delivery pipe is provided with an oil pump, one side of the oil pump is fixedly connected with one side of the rust-proof oil tank, and the bottom of the rust-proof oil tank is fixedly connected with the top of the connecting block.
